Installing a Fireplace on Wall
A fireplace feature wall can be an ideal way to improve the design of your home. These modern fireplaces can be easily installed and can be hung wherever. You can also pick a gas or electric model.
Be sure to read the safety guidelines prior to deciding to purchase a wall-mounted fireplace. Follow the guidelines provided by the manufacturer for mounting.
Surface-mounted electric fireplaces
If you are interested in installing a fireplace in your wall, there are plenty of options to choose from. Electric fireplaces are available in a variety of designs, including the surface mounted and recessed. Both are easy to install and offer a beautiful, unique look in any room. It is essential to do your research before buying a new fireplace. Be sure to follow the instructions carefully to avoid any issues or mistakes.
If you prefer a sleek, modern look and style, then a wall-mounted electric fireplace may be the perfect choice for your home. This kind of fireplace is ideal to be placed above a television and can be used to create a focal point within your living space. It is available in a variety of widths and finishes that can be matched to any style. They are also simple to set up and don't require chimneys or venting system.
Some models of this type of fireplace include an inbuilt heater that can be turned on and off when required. Some models can be controlled remotely using a remote control or by pressing a key on the unit. The majority of these models come with different flame colors and fire bed media colors. Some even allow you to select the color of your flames, and the fire pit display can rotate through all the options automatically.
A recessed electric fire place is a different option. It can be put in any wall without framing it or cutting the wall. These are great for homes where the traditional wood fireplaces-burning fireplace is not permitted. They are available in a variety of dimensions and styles. They also come with an electric heater built-in to add warmth to a room.
The Scion Trinity is one of the best recessed fireplaces available. It is available in several sizes and offers three color options for glass. The flames are enclosed by an ember bed you can customize to suit your interior.
It is possible to put a TV over a fireplace that is recessed However, be sure to follow the manufacturer's installation guidelines for this model. Make sure you read the directions carefully, as they could differ slightly from model to model. You should also ensure that the fireplace is mounted securely to the wall studs. It could fall and cause damage to the house and injuries to anyone inside the room.
Electric fireplaces with wall-mounted electrical outlets
A wall-mounted electric fire is a great addition for any room. It can be positioned on top of a flat-screen TV or in a niche. Many models come with a mantle and shiplap panel that can be matched to your decor. Some models come with glass surrounds that help prevent burns caused by falling embers. Electric fireplaces that are mounted on a wall do not require venting, and can be used either with or without heat.
A wall-mounted electric fireplace that has faux-stone finishes is also available. This model is perfect for under a flat-screen TV. It is an attractive backdrop to display photographs, candles or other decorative objects. You can place speakers and DVD players on the mantel. The most appealing aspect is that you can use this wall-mounted device all year long, without or with heat.
Most wall-mounted electric fireplaces have a fan-forced heater that can heat rooms up to 400 square feet. They are a great way to increase the heat in your home and create a cozy environment with glowing logs and realistic flame effects. Certain models are also CSA certified for safety. Certain models come with an automatic shut-off aswell as thermal overload protection.
The Modern Flames Landscape Pro Multi is a favorite choice due to the fact that it features realistic flames, a custom color selection, and intelligent home connectivity. Other options include the Dimplex Ignite XL Bold and the Scion Trinity.
Touchstone Onyx is another option for a fireplace that can be mounted on the wall. It has an ultra-slim frame and built-in mounting brackets, making it easy to mount. It comes with a Bluetooth sync and remote control, which increases its versatility.
While the ambiance of an electric fireplace mounted on the wall is attractive, it's important to think about the space you have available in your home prior to deciding on one. You will need at least some studs on the wall for this type of fireplace inserts. If you don't have enough space you may need to build an enclosure for your fireplace. It's also important to think about the size of the fireplace which will affect how well it fits in your home.
Electric fireplaces that are inset
Inset electric fireplaces are the ideal solution for those looking for the appearance of a fire to be integrated into a wall. Also called insert fires they are designed to fit into existing fireplace suites and openings, including some new builds. Inset electric fireplaces don't require a flue or chimney, making them easier to install.
Electric fires that are set into walls can be used to create an attractive focal point or an accent piece. There are a myriad of styles to choose from including simple contemporary designs to more traditional ones. Some are compatible with smart home technology, which means you can control them with your voice or an app. This makes them ideal for modern living spaces as well as open plan homes.
You can also find electric fireplaces that are either partially or completely recessed into the wall if space is a problem. This allows for more room to be saved while also giving a sleeker and more sophisticated appearance. Certain models come with a trim skirt to cover any gap between the fireplace and the wall.
A wall-mounted, electric fire TV stand is another popular option. They can be an excellent option to add a unique feature to a entertainment device and are typically constructed from high-quality materials. Some models are designed with a storage area which allows you to keep your media and other belongings well-organized.
These are ideal for those who do not want to remove their fireplace surround or do not have a suitable opening for a chimney. They're simple to install and can be connected to an electrical outlet. Some come with a remote so you can easily switch off and on the lights.
Electric fireplaces aren't just attractive, but they can also be extremely efficient sources of heat. Electric fireplaces typically consume between 1.4 to 1.6 1 kW. This is enough to warm a small or medium sized space comfortably. They can be operated on a 'flame only' setting or with a fan to provide additional warmth.
Built-in electric fireplaces
A built-in fireplace is a wonderful addition to any home, and it can be especially beautiful when it's receded into the wall. These models are designed to resemble the flat-screen television or picture, but they have a real flame and provide warmth. They also remove chimneys, so you can install them in places that don't have room for an ordinary fireplace. Additionally, they are safer for curious pets and kids than a traditional fire.
These fireplaces are a favorite among buyers due to their unique design and easy installation. These fireplaces are ideal for a variety of settings, including bedrooms and living rooms. Some models even come with the option of a remote so that you can control the flames and heat from any place in your home. Another advantage of this type of fireplace is that it can be used all the year. However, it's important to be aware of the various types of electric fireplaces, so it's essential to read the instructions carefully before installing it.
The Superior 60" ERC4060 is one of the most fashionable and affordable electric fireplaces available on the market. It features a modern black trim that blends seamlessly with the faux logs as well as a contemporary crystal-clear ethonal fire bed. The controls are hidden behind the grille grate on the top of the fireplace. The easy-to-read instruction manual includes a list of safety and features as well as a diagram. Its high customer ratings and outstanding warranty are further proof of its quality and reliability.
Electric fireplaces with built-ins are ideal for homeowners who wish to make a focal point of their home without adding a chimney. Available in sizes of 48 to 72 inches. Many come with a decorative surround and can be hung on the wall or recessed in the wall to create a stylish, built-in appearance. They are also energy efficient, using between 750 and 1,500 watts of heat.
